Vinegar-soaked ginger is a perfect combination of vinegar and ginger. When eating crabs in autumn, people in the Jiangnan region will use shredded ginger vinegar to eat crabs. Both have outstanding nutritional value, can regulate cardiovascular, sterilize and detoxify, and have many benefits to the body. Ginger itself is an anti-aging ingredient, so it is also suitable for the elderly. Let's take a look at the effects and functions of vinegar-soaked ginger.
